About 27 Ince Road
27 Ince Road is a three-bedroom detached house in Liverpool (L23 4UE). It has a recorded floor area of 122 m² (around 1313 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(August 2014)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). The latest certificate is from August 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 122 m² it sits well below the postcode median (190 m² across 11 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£494,000 is 28.3%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£293/sq ft) was about 39.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sold in November 2015, so it's been off the market for around 11 years.
